JOB SUMMARY
-
The Staff Pharmacist works under the supervision of the Director of Pharmacy to manage care of both hospital inpatients and outpatients in our outpatient oncology department and infusion clinic.
The Staff Pharmacist will: -
Create chemotherapy care plan templates in coordination with oncology staff, recommending appropriate doses, dosing adjustments where appropriate, and providing drug information.
-
Assist with manipulation of Cerner to improve and maintain safe and effective use of medications throughout the facility. Manipulations may involve drug formulary maintenance from ordering to administration to billing.
-
Open service requests with Cerner on behalf of the pharmacy when needed and be responsible for testing requested changes, as well as testing and implementing changes to the Cerner Pharmnet applications as required for Cerner updates.
-
Work with the revenue cycle specialist to ensure accurate pharmacy billing for the hospital and all RMH campus locations.
-
Coordinate with other hospital clinicians to create and maintain hospital order sets in Cerner.
-
Assist with the creation and maintenance of pharmacy policy and procedure, facility protocols, and care plans.
-
Assist with IV pump programming to ensure accuracy with changes to the pharmacy formulary or changes to IV protocols.
-
Work shifts in the outpatient setting as scheduled.
